Memories of Spain, part 4

We spent May 9th visiting Merida, or "Merinda" as Chris had often referred to it. In fairness to Chris, the locals had also corrupted the name. The original name of the town was Augusta Merita, as in "Merit". It had been founded as a settlement for Roman legionnaires who had finished their terms of service by Emperor Augustus.
To say that the Romans had left their mark on the place is a considerable understatement. The place was filled with Roman ruins. The most impressive of these was the amphitheater as it had been partially restored. I wonder if Merida's Plaza de Toros will be as impressive in two thousand years.
